Abstract
Tellurium was determined spectrophotometrically at 635 nm and pH 5.3 based on its catalytic reduction of Toluidine Blue in the presence of Te(IV) by using a flow -injection system. Under the optimized experimental conditions, the detection limit is 60 ng/ml of tellurium ion and the linear range is 80–3800 ng/ml (110 μl, injection). The relative standard deviation of 10 replicate measurements is 1.5% for a 1.5 μg/ml of tellurium. The sampling rate is 25 h-1.
